Hi Chandra

You can assign a revision level to a material either from an ECM # or while you are processing a material master record or BOM for the material.

Prerequisites

You can only assign a revision level to a material that has a material master record.

If you create a material with Create Immediately, the system creates a material master record immediately. In this case, the revision level can also be allocated immediately.

If you create a material with Create Schedule, the system first creates a document (and no material master record). In this case, the revision level cannot be assigned yet. The material master record is not created until you activate the scheduled material, and then a revision level can also be assigned.

Procedure

From the Engineering Change Management menu, choose the Revision level option. The following options are available: create, change, and display material revision level.

To create a revision level for a material:

Choose Logistics >>Central functions>>ECM>> Revision Level >> Create. (CC11)

In the initial screen

Enter the material that you want to assign a revision level to and select .

You see the Create Revision Level: Detail.

Enter the change number that you want to assign a revision level to.

The possible entries in the Revision level field depend on your company-specific settings (Customizing for Engineering change management under Set up control data).

If internal number assignment is defined for revision levels, do not make an entry in the Revision level field. Confirm your entry. The system assigns the next available revision level from the defined number sequence. You can overwrite this default value with another value. However, the revision level you enter must be defined in the sequence and must not have been assigned to the material so far.

If external number assignment is defined for revision levels, the system still assigns the next available revision level from the defined number sequence. You can overwrite this default value with another value. However, the revision level you enter need not be defined in the sequence.

You can define the settings in Customizing such that a higher revision level must be assigned for both external and internal number assignment.

A message appears telling you which revision level has been assigned to the material.

Save the revision level for your material.

When assigning the revision level from the processing functions for the material master or the bill of material, you find the functions for maintaining the revision level under the menu option Extras.

create change number in CC01 then assign object in that like this change number is active for material or/and BOM or/and Routing or/and documents

once you create you can assign material in respective views or gotot CC11 assign

rev. level is client level so not possible
